Zinc dialkyldithiophosphate (ZDTP) is a complex compound known as a lubricant additive that has many functions such as anticorrosive, antifriction, and antioxidants. Zinc diisoamyldithiophosphate (ZDTPi) was synthesized using isoamyl alcohol in chloroform medium and was characterized for its anticorrosive performance using potentiodynamic polarization method. The measurement at concentration of 0.5, 1, 2, and 3% (w/v) indicated that the effectiveness of the inhibition of Cu metal corrosion increased in line with the addition of ZDTPi concentration. The thermodynamic parameters verification indicated that the ΔG* value increased from blank to sample; showing that the spontaneity of corrosion decreased in the presence of corrosion inhibitors. The activation energy of the sample was higher than the blank. Based on the increase of the minimum reaction energy, this phenomenon indicates the decreasing corrosion rate.
